5. AL: Chapman seeking electronic voting for Alabama military


MONTGOMERY (AP) — Alabama's chief election official said Thursday she hopes to have a pilot project for electronic voting by Alabama's military overseas by the 2008 presidential election.

Secretary of State Beth Chapman made the comment after a conference call with key leaders of national military voting organizations to seek their help in developing a system to replace mailed absentee ballots for Alabama military and their families overseas.

Chapman talked with top officials from the Overseas Vote Foundation, the Federal Voting Assistance Program of the Department of Defense, and the U.S. Election Assistance Commission, and she expressed her support and the governor's for a more up-to-date voting method for Alabamians who are abroad at election time.
